Veteran S'pore actor Bai Yan passes away at 100

A life well-lived.

Guan Zhen Tan | August 19, 2019, 11:06 AM

Bai Yan, one of the most revered veteran actors in the local entertainment industry has passed away.

According to Lianhe Zaobao, the veteran actor passed away on August 19, 2019.

He was 100.

Started acting for local television at 65

Born in Wuhan, China, in 1920, he was part of a performing troupe that came over to Singapore.

He only joined the television industry in 1985 when he was 65-years-old, with his debut TV appearance in Blossoms in the Sun (阳光蜜糖).

Bai would go on to act in memorable shows such as We Are Family (四代同堂) Son of Pulau Tekong (亚答籽), Five Foot Way (五脚基) and Pretty Faces (三面夏娃).

Celebrated his 100th birthday this year

When he received the Special Achievement Award in 1996, Bai humbly downplayed his contribution and even expressed that he felt ashamed to receive the award back then.

Earlier this year on May 5, he had celebrated his 100th birthday with around 130 Mediacorp artistes and crew at the Yummy Palace restaurant, more than 20 years after he had retired.

The celebration was organised by people from the acting industry to express their heartfelt appreciation for Bai.

Notable local actors were in attendance, such as Zoe Tay, Aileen Tan, Chen Xiu Huan, Hong Hui Fang, Zheng Ge Ping and Choo Hou Ren.
